About US Aggregates
US Aggregates is a privately held, family-owned business headquartered in Indianapolis. With over 20 operations across Indiana, US Aggregates has been a customer-focused, innovative provider of high-quality essential stone, sand and gravel used in road construction, site prep and utilities, agriculture and erosion control. The company also specializes in industrial minerals like dolomitic and high-calcium products. Since 1967, US Aggregates has built a reputation for prioritizing safety, quality and community.
